Contrast

#2fa761 as textRatioAAAA largeAAAFix
Aaon white
3.08:1failpassfail
  • AA: use #26874f as the text (4.51:1)
  • AAA: use #1c633a as the text (7.25:1)
  • AA: or shift the background to #2b2b2b (4.6:1)
Aaon black
6.82:1passpassfail
  • AAA: use #30ab63 as the text (7.13:1)

Fixes keep hue and saturation and move lightness only, so the suggestion stays on-brand. Ratios are symmetric: the same numbers apply with #2fa761 as the background.
